Support for French Speaking Newcomers

Canada Strengthens Support for French Speaking Newcomers Integration in 2026

Canada continues to lead with purpose when it comes to inclusive immigration. In January 2026, the Government of Canada reinforced its support for French-speaking newcomers integration with a focused investment aimed at helping Francophone immigrants build strong roots across the country. This initiative highlights something very important. Canada does not just welcome newcomers. Canada ensures they belong.

Through a new three-year funding initiative, the government is supporting projects that help French-speaking newcomers connect socially, professionally, and culturally within their host communities. This step reflects Canada’s long-standing vision of unity, inclusion, and community strength.

How Canada Is Supporting Community Growth Through Culture and Business

The recent funding initiative focuses on creating tools and resources that bring business leaders, cultural leaders and newcomers together. This creates a strong bridge between opportunity and belonging. Newcomers are given clear pathways to participate in community life. They are encouraged to engage in cultural activities. They are supported in finding employment that matches their skills.

A National Vision for Inclusive Growth

Canada’s approach to immigration has always been rooted in balance. Economic growth and social harmony go hand in hand. Cultural diversity and national unity work together. By strengthening French speaking newcomers integration, Canada is protecting the vitality of official language minority communities while creating new opportunities for skilled immigrants to thrive. Between now and 2028, projects will be delivered across multiple provinces and territories. These initiatives are designed to create environments where newcomers feel confident, welcomed and supported.
